A Colorado staple of slow-smoked beef brisket, ribs, or pulled pork. Springs barbecue spots often pair it with regional sauces and mountain-casual dining.
Green chiles roasted and simmered into a pork-based stew or sauce. Popular across southern Colorado and a defining local comfort food with Southwestern roots.
A hearty breakfast of fried tortillas, eggs, cheese, and chile sauce. Common in Colorado diners and loved for its New Mexico-influenced flavor.
